Summary of Board and Planning Commission Direction This document summarizes direction received from the Planning Commission at a series of three work sessions in 2003. It is accompanied by an appendix with supporting demographic data and an overview on deed restrictions. Program Name The term “Community Housing’ will be used to describe housing programs and units that might result from this effort. Intended Beneficiaries e Gunnison County's Community Housing efforts will seek to insure that a broad range of housing opportunities are available for a diverse population. Emphasis will be targeted on year-round residents though the needs of seasonal workers who support our economy are not to be ignored. e Inthe future, at least 25% if not more of the county's housing should be appropriate and affordable for families with children. (In 2000, 25% of the county's households included at least one child.) e Inthe future, the percentage of housing available and affordable for seniors should increase with growth in demand above the 2000 level of 11%. e Efforts to address the unique housing needs of specific market segments, like Hispanic workers, should be considered.
